Question 853825: 6 qts of a 72% alcohol solution was mixed with 12 qts. of a 36% alcohol solution. Find the concentration of the new mixture.
Answer by Alan3354(69443)   (Show Source): You can put this solution on YOUR website!
6*72 + 12*36 = 18*Conc
